Banging noises are frequently caused by out of balance doors. It's important to get this problem repaired sooner rather than later to prevent other damage from taking place.
As your garage door gets older, the weather stripping or trim may deteriorate and need repair. Replacing the weather stripping will help insulate your garage and keep unwanted critters outside.
Rattling noises may be caused by loose nuts or bolts, dry parts needing lubrication , misaligned doors, or a garage door opener that was not correctly installed.
Scraping noises are usually caused by misaligned doors.
Squeaking sounds might be due to a loose roller or hinge, parts needing oiling, or unbalanced doors.
Rubbing could be the result of bent tracks or a jammed or tight track which needs repair.
Grinding noises may be caused by parts needing lubrication, loose rollers or hinges, a stripped garage door opener gear, or an incorrectly installed opener.
Slapping noises are often caused by a loose chain.
Vibrating sounds are sometimes caused by loose parts or rollers needing grease.
Popping noises may be caused by torsion spring issues.

The average life of a garage door opener is about 10-15 years. Proper maintenance, greasing, and checking that your garage door is in balance will aid in extending the lifespan of your opener. For safety reasons, if you own a garage door opener that was built before 1993, it’s recommended to have it replaced instead of repaired.
